다음과 같이 나이스페이 결제창을 팝업 띄워 이용하고 있는데요.
var formNm = document.frmRegular;
formNm.action = 'url';
var left = (screen.Width - 545) / 2;
var top = (screen.Height - 573) / 2;
var winopts = "left=" + left + ",top=" + top + ",width=545,height=573,toolbar=no,location=no,directories=no,status=yes,menubar=no,scrollbars=no,resizable=no";
win = window.open("", "billWindow", winopts);
formNm.target = "billWindow";
formNm.submit();
카카오스토리 인앱 브라우저에서 실행하면 결제화면으로 “띄워” 지는것 같진않고 "넘어"가는 것처럼 결제창이 뜹니다.
문제는 결제가 완료된 이후
opener.함수 를 불러오는 과정에서 opener가 팝업을 띄운 부모창이 아닌지 해당 opener.함수 가 undefined 로 나오네요.